After impressively defeating Jo Jo Dan in Sheffield in March Kell Brook makes a quick return to the ring on Saturday 30 May to defend his IBF Welterweight title against Frankie Gavin at The O2 in London, exclusively live on Sky Sports Box Office.

Brook v Gavin headlines a huge night of boxing that includes three world title fights – WBC Lightweight Champion Jorge Linares defends his title against popular Londoner Kevin Mitchell and Welsh stylist Lee Selby challenges Evgeny Gradovich for his IBF Featherweight title. Rising Heavyweight star Anthony Joshua MBE has his toughest encounter yet facing former World Heavyweight title challenger Kevin ‘Kingpin’ Johnson.

Kell Brook retained his IBF World welterweight title in blistering fashion tonight, demolishing brave Romanian challenger Jo Jo Dan inside 4 rounds.

Brook sent out a chilling message to the rest of the welterweight division by flooring Dan four times in front of a rapturous home support to finally consummate the championship he won superbly 7 months ago.

From the moment ‘All of the Lights’ erupted throughout the arena and the beloved champion rose from the bowels of his fortress, he looked up to the sky and you felt the weight of a tumultuous 6 months lift from his shoulders.

This was the Kell Brook from Carson City in August and Jo Jo Dan had absolutely no answer to him.

Kell Brook sent out a chilling warning to his Welterweight rivals by dishing out a devastating four-round beating to mandatory challenger Jo Jo Dan in the first defence of his IBF World title at the Motorpoint Arena in Sheffield on Saturday night (March 28)

Brook came to the ring to a rapturous reception and rose to the occasion like an elite World ruler. The Sheffield star eased into the opening round and Dan felt the first of many right hands in the second half of the first stanza.

A sign of things to follow came in the second round as Dan hit the canvas early and then again after making the count, both from right uppercuts. The Romanian-Canadian was wobbled once more with a minute to go but gritted his teeth to hear the bell.

Kell Brook steps between the ropes for the first time as a World champion on Saturday night as he defends his IBF Welterweight title at the Motorpoint Arena in Sheffield against Jo Jo Dan in ‘Unbreakable’ presented by FX World, live on Sky Sports – after fearing he may never walk again after the shocking attack he suffered on holiday in Spain in September.

Brook ripped the title from Shawn Porter in Los Angeles in August with a stunning performance in the American’s backyard, but just two weeks after that win, Brook was fighting for his life in hospital after a machete attack whilst on holiday in Spain.
